Abstract: PURPOSE: A vehicle power generation control system for full-charging and a controlling method thereof are provided to improve gas mileage by using driving information of a vehicle. CONSTITUTION: A generator(20) generates power by using the rotation power of an engine. A battery(10) is charged with power from the generator. A nonvolatile storage medium(32) uses information collected from the engine, the generator, and the battery. The nonvolatile storage medium accumulates data to analyze the collected information. It is determined whether to satisfy an entry condition of a full-charging control using analysis data stored in the storage medium. Abstract: PURPOSE: A method for judging an ISG(Idle Stop and Go) air conditioning condition is provided to reduce costs as ISG prohibition logic is performed by only the modeling of air-conditioning states without a communication network and sensor. CONSTITUTION: A method for judging an ISG(Idle Stop and Go) air conditioning condition comprises following steps. Whether or not the ISG is performed with a current air conditioning condition is determined in a state where ISG logic is operated. The predicted temperature of external air is calculated on the basis of the modeling which uses information from a vehicle(S10,S20). The voltage of an air conditioning system is detected(S30). Whether or not the predicted temperature of the external air and the voltage of the air conditioning system are below a value for operating the ISG is determined(S40,41). If the value for operating the ISG is satisfied, an engine is controlled(S50,51). Abstract: PURPOSE: A folding headrest for vehicle seats is provided to enable a user to easily fold a headrest by a hinge cover assembly and a pole guide. CONSTITUTION: A folding headrest for vehicle seats comprises a headrest(100), a headrest pole(210), a pole guide(220), and a hinge cover assembly(230). The headrest is installed to be foldable. The headrest pole is coupled with the headrest and supports the headrest. The headrest pole is folded with the headrest. The pole guide fixes the headrest pole to prevent the separation of the headrest pole. The hinge cover assembly comprises the rotation hinge and the spring. The hinge cover assembly folds the headrest and the headrest pole with the spring tension when the headrest pole is on the top.

Abstract: PURPOSE: A device for walkin and folding a seat is provided to independently perform a walkin function and a folding function using minimum components. CONSTITUTION: A device for walkin and folding a seat comprises a cushion frame(300), a locking link(500), a walkin pin(700), and a pressing part. The locking link is installed in the cushion frame using an elastic hinge(510) and is connected to a locking unit using a first wire(W1). The walkin pin is installed in a seat back frame(100) using an elastic hinge(710). The pressing part is installed in the center of the locking link using the elastic hinge. One end of the pressing part is connected to the first wire, and the other end is pressed by the walkin pin.

Abstract: PURPOSE: An automatic headrest is provided to facilitate attachment and detachment to a seat frame for securing rear view, thereby promoting safe driving. CONSTITUTION: An automatic headrest includes a locking groove, a lift slider, a locking piece, and a release bracket. The locking groove is formed on the bottom of a headrest pole(100). The lift slider(200) is mounted to ascend and descend on a seat frame, and has a mounting groove in which the bottom of the headrest pole is inserted. The locking piece is installed on the mounting groove to hang on the locking groove when the headrest pole is inserted in the mounting groove. The release bracket(400) is fixed to the seat frame and penetrated by the headrest pole.

Abstract: PURPOSE: An electromechanical valve train is provided to reduce noise when a valve is landed on a valve seat by installing a slider for reducing the moving speed of the valve at one side of an armature plate. CONSTITUTION: An interval maintaining member is formed at an inner center portion of a housing(31) in order to maintain an interval between a closing coil(33) and an opening coil(34). An upper magnet(35) is formed at an upper portion of the closing coil(33). A lower magnet(36) is positioned at a lower portion of the opening coil(34). A central shaft(37) passes through center portions of the upper and lower magnets(35,36). An armature plate(38) is coupled to a center portion of the central shaft(37). A spring(39) is formed at an upper portion of the upper magnet(35). One end of the spring(39) is elastically supported by a supporting plate.

Abstract: PURPOSE: An electro mechanical valve train is provided to improve responsibility through actively operating an armature. CONSTITUTION: To close a valve, currents are applied to a first coil(14) and a second coil(16). Then, armature sides of the coils contain S polarity. In case of applying currents to a third coil(44) for an upper end to be N polarity and a lower end to be S polarity, an armature(18) contains N polarity at an upper plate(38) and S polarity at a lower plate(40). The lower surface of the first coil contains S polarity, and the upper plate of the armature contains N polarity to form attraction. An upper surface of the second coil contains S polarity, and the lower plate of the armature contains S polarity to form repulsive force. Therefore, the armature is elevated with a valve(20). Thus, an intake port and an exhaust port of a cylinder head are closed. To open the valve, currents are flowed to the first coil and the second coil in an opposite direction so that the valve is lowered to open the ports.

Abstract: PURPOSE: An electro mechanical valve engine starting method of a vehicle is provided to precisely start the engine within a load of a battery through identifying a closing time of an intake valve and applying time of start power. CONSTITUTION: After turning on an engine start(300), an ECU(Electronic Control Unit) and an electro mechanical valve controller are initialized(301). Then, an intake valve is closed while turning on a starter(302). After rotating an engine, engine RPM(Revolutions Per Minute) is detected(303). In case of the engine RPM at 200 RPM, strokes of each cylinder are detected for closing an exhaust valve of the cylinder in an exhaust stroke(305). After injecting fuel, an intake valve is opened . Then, the intake valve is closed to perform compression and ignition. After transferring driving force, the exhaust valve is opened. After closing the exhaust valve, the engine RPM is detected. Synchronous fuel is injected until the engine RPM at 600 RPM to perform suction, compression, and exhaustion.
